I understand that you have Genius Mixes in iTunes on your Mac and when you try to sync your device to iTunes and exclude some music from those mixes, the unwanted music is still synced over to your device. To exclude the music you do not want, you may need to remove the entire mix that contains that music you no longer want. To sync selected Genius playlists and Genius Mixes to your device:
- In iTunes, select your device in the device list and click the Music tab (or button, depending on the version of iTunes being used).
- Check Sync Music, and then choose "Selected playlists, artists, and genres."
- Under Playlists, select the Genius playlists and Genius Mixes you want.
- Click Apply.
Notes:
- Genius Mixes can only be synced automatically, so you won't be able to add Genius Mixes to your device if "Sync only checked songs and videos" is checked in the iTunes Summary pane.
- If you select any Genius Mixes to sync with your device, iTunes may select and sync additional songs from your library that you didn’t select.
- If you choose to sync your entire music library, iTunes will sync all your Genius playlists and Genius Mixes to the device.
